Meaning

This name derives from the Old Norse “Hærfreðr,” composed of two elements: “*hariaR” (army, army leader, commander, warrior) plus “*friðuR” (peace, tranquility, friendship). In turn, the name means “friend of the army, army pacifier.”

Etymology & Details

Name Root

*hariaR *friðuR > Hærfreðr
